How Gutters Can Cause Fascia And Soffit Damage
Gutters sit at the roof’s edge and are supposed to move water away from fascia, soffit, and the foundation. When they fail, the water that would have been carried away instead puddles against or soaks into the fascia board and the underside of the eave (the soffit). Over time this moisture leads to swelling, rot, paint failure, mold growth, and insect infestation. But gutters don’t have to be obvious failures to cause trouble, small, persistent problems are often worse than dramatic collapses.
Common gutter-related failure modes include clogged gutters, poor slope, small leaks at seams or downspouts, undersized downspouts during heavy storms, and gutters detached from the fascia. Each produces a distinct water pattern. Clogs cause localized overflow that soaks the fascia beneath the blockage. Poor slope results in standing water that soaks through fastener holes and under the gutter flange. Leaks and split seams spray water directly onto the fascia and soffit. When gutters pull away from the fascia, the attachment points and the wood behind them are exposed to concentrated water and movement, accelerating deterioration.
Another less obvious mechanism is repeated wet-dry cycles. Fascia and soffit often survive occasional wetting, but when gutters cause daily splashing or regular overflow, the wood never dries completely. That leads to progressive breakdown of paint and sealants, making subsequent water intrusion easier and faster. Finally, pests like carpenter ants and wood-boring insects are attracted to damp wood, turning a small gutter issue into a much larger structural and health concern.
How To Inspect, Diagnose, And Rule Out Other Causes
A careful inspection helps us separate gutter-driven damage from other causes such as roof leaks, poor ventilation, or original installation defects. Start from the ground with binoculars and then move closer if needed, look for sagging gutters, visible seams, and paint lines where water consistently tracks. Inside the attic, look for stains on roof sheathing near the eave, which suggest roof leaks rather than gutter overflow. Pay attention to staining patterns: gutter overflow typically leaves vertical streaks beneath the gutter or concentrated stains where water spills, while roof leaks often show up further up the roof deck or near penetrations.
Smell and texture are useful: musty, moldy odors in attic spaces and soft, spongy fascia are classic signs of chronic moisture. Also check for insect activity, sawdust, small holes, or tunnels near the soffit area indicate pests attracted by damp wood. Document what you find with photos: they’ll be useful if you consult a contractor or file an insurance claim.
If the attic is accessible, we recommend getting up there after a rain to observe active leaks or drips. If you can’t get into the attic safely, perform a controlled test from the ground: have someone run a hose along short sections of roof and gutter while you watch for overflow, leaks, or water tracking into the soffit. This helps rule out isolated roof leaks and confirms whether the gutter is the source of the problem.
Repair, Replacement, Costs, And When To Call A Professional
Minor damage can often be fixed without full replacement. If we find localized rot in the fascia less than about 6–12 inches long, we can remove the rotted section, treat the surrounding wood with a preservative, and splice in a new piece with corrosion-resistant fasteners and exterior-grade adhesive. For small soffit openings or vent damage, patching with matching materials and repainting will usually suffice. Resealing seams, tightening brackets, realigning slope, and adding gutter guards are cost-effective interventions that stop further harm.
When the damage is extensive, multiple rotted fascia sections, sagging gutters over long runs, or compromised roof sheathing, replacement is the safer option. Full fascia replacement typically runs $10–$25 per linear foot for labor and materials on common wood boards: vinyl or aluminum replacements vary depending on finish and profile. Complete gutter replacement is commonly $5–$15 per linear foot depending on material (vinyl, aluminum, steel, or copper) and complexity. Replacing soffit can range widely: $3–$10 per square foot for common materials, more for vented or specialty finishes.
Call a professional when structural members are compromised, when damage extends into the roof decking, or when you’re unsure of roof integrity. Professionals will also spot secondary issues, hidden mold, insulation damage, or fascia fasteners that have pulled through, and provide warranty options. For insurance claims, a contractor’s report helps substantiate cause and recommended repairs. If safety is a concern (steep roofs, high ladders), don’t attempt a risky DIY, hire a licensed roofer or siding contractor.

Simple Homeowner Checklist
Use this quick checklist during your inspection or maintenance routine:
- Clean gutters twice a year (spring and fall) and after major storms.
- Check gutter slope: water should flow toward downspouts without pooling.
- Look for leaks at seams and around downspouts: reseal with exterior-grade sealant.
- Tighten or replace loose hangers and brackets: add hangers every 24–36 inches on long runs.
- Inspect fascia for soft spots and paint failure: probe suspicious areas with a screwdriver.
- Open soffit vents visually and from the attic to ensure they aren’t blocked by insulation.
- Test with a hose to simulate heavy rain and watch for overflow or spray onto fascia/soffit.
- Trim overhanging branches that drop debris into gutters or hold moisture near eaves.
- Consider gutter guards and properly sized downspouts to reduce clogging during storms.
Keeping a log of inspections and repairs helps us spot recurring issues and decide when full replacement is the better long-term investment.
